Hey guys, I am interested in using Streetdeck with Vista so that I can take advantage of Vistas better audio processing and sampler. I know Streetdeck needs WMP to play music files but is there anything done in the background when those files are called up with Streetdeck that would affect their sound quality when compared to playing them straight from WMP?
Thanks
No, StreetDeck should sound exactly the same. It uses the built in equalizer and other audio processing in WMP.

Thanks for the reply Jan. I'm aware that WMP is not optimum, but in my case I want to get the best sound out of Rhapsody downloaded subscription files so I will need WMP. I assume Winamp can play these files too but I have been told from a developer of Winamp that since the files are DRM'd they will not output threw an ASIO type setup. This is the reason I was looking into Vista which from what I've read will give me acceptable results and still let me navigate my music threw Streetdeck.
If all you're going to be playing is downloaded files, then the difference will be neglegable.
If we were talking about lossless files or CDs then there would be a noticeable difference.
